

In this episode, Dan covers the TSP surpassing $1 trillion and what it means for retirement savings, while Katelyn examines the cancellation of the Federal Employee Viewpoint Survey, its impact on agencies and employees, and alternatives moving forward.
Dan covers the Thrift Savings Plan surpassing the $1 trillion mark and what this milestone means for federal retirement savings. He explains where the TSP now stands among retirement funds, then breaks down the numbers-total assets, participant count, and average TSP and FERS balances. He highlights the implications for federal employees, emphasizing strength, stability, and continued growth, while also sharing key takeaways and caveats for contributors to keep in mind.
Katelyn turns to the Federal Employee Viewpoint Survey, which has traditionally measured leadership, workload, morale, and engagement to guide agency management decisions. She outlines the importance of this data, why its cancellation in 2025 should concern agencies, employees, and oversight bodies, and the potential ripple effects on career and financial planning. She also points to alternative ways employees can stay informed.
